# set PATHNAME to directory where the jar files exist, relative to this directory
PATHNAME = ../../../ODE_solvers/jar_files

# specify compiler, but allow makefile in parent directory to override assignment
JAVAC ?= javac

# specify interpreter, but allow makefile in parent directory to override assignment
JAVA ?= java


compile : PlFTest.class Poly.class ErkTripleTest.class

run : PlFTest.class Poly.class ErkTripleTest.class
	$(JAVA) -classpath .:$(PATHNAME)/odeToJava.jar ErkTripleTest

clean :
	rm -f *.class
	rm -f *.txt


PlFTest.class : PlFTest.java
	$(JAVAC) -classpath $(PATHNAME)/odeToJava.jar PlFTest.java

Poly.class : Poly.java
	$(JAVAC) -classpath $(PATHNAME)/odeToJava.jar Poly.java

ErkTripleTest.class : ErkTripleTest.java
	$(JAVAC) -classpath .:$(PATHNAME)/odeToJava.jar ErkTripleTest.java
